Sure, there might be a torrent but without a original hash from a trustable source I'm not too eager to download it. In order to setup a Jumpstart server using the Solaris 9 CD's you need tohave access to both slice 0 and slice 1 on the CDs.

If you're using aphysical CD then thats not a problem - vold will automatically mount bothof the required slices for you, or if you're not using vold you can mountthem manually yourself. However, if you're trying to use an ISO image, mounted using the 'lofi'driver, then you've got a problem as lofi is not VTOC aware, which inshort means that it has no way of knowing that slice 1 even exists,let alone being able to access it.

In order to fix this you need to split the contents of slice 1 into it'sown image file that you can then point lofiadm at. The procedure for doingthis is described below I'm presuming you've already download the ISO images for Solaris 9, whichmeans you should already have two files which look something like thefollowing :.
